The Benefits of Science Education

1. Fostering Curiosity: Science education encourages individuals to ask questions, explore new ideas, and seek evidence-based explanations. It feeds their curiosity and nurtures a lifelong love for learning.

2. Developing Critical Thinking Skills: Science education equips students with the tools to analyze information, evaluate evidence, and make informed decisions. It promotes rational thinking and trains individuals to think critically and skeptically.

3. Promoting Problem-Solving Abilities: Science education teaches students how to approach problems systematically, break them down into manageable parts, and develop logical solutions. These problem-solving skills are valuable not only in science but also in various other aspects of life.

4. Enhancing Everyday Life: Science education provides individuals with the knowledge and skills to understand and engage with the world around them. It helps them make sense of technology, health, and the environment, enabling them to make informed decisions for themselves and their communities.

Challenges in Science Education

Despite the undeniable benefits of science education, several challenges need to be addressed:

1. Lack of Resources: Insufficient funding often leads to a lack of laboratory equipment, technology, and quality teaching materials. This restricts hands-on learning experiences, hindering students’ engagement with science.

2. Teacher Shortage: There is a shortage of qualified science teachers worldwide. This shortage not only affects the quality of instruction but also limits the opportunities for meaningful interactions and mentorship.

3. Social and Cultural Barriers: Gender and cultural stereotypes can discourage certain groups from pursuing science education. It is crucial to create inclusive learning environments that inspire and support students from diverse backgrounds.
